> On 9/28/21 8:47 PM, Ricardo Koller wrote:
> > Verify that the redistributor regions do not extend beyond the
> > VM-specified IPA range (phys_size). This can happen when using
> > KVM_VGIC_V3_ADDR_TYPE_REDIST or KVM_VGIC_V3_ADDR_TYPE_REDIST_REGIONS
> > with:
> >
> >   base + size > phys_size AND base < phys_size
> >
> > Add the missing check into vgic_v3_alloc_redist_region() which is called
> > when setting the regions, and into vgic_v3_check_base() which is called
> > when attempting the first vcpu-run. The vcpu-run check does not apply to
> > KVM_VGIC_V3_ADDR_TYPE_REDIST_REGIONS because the regions size is known
> > before the first vcpu-run. Note that using the REDIST_REGIONS API
> > results in a different check, which already exists, at first vcpu run:
> > that the number of redist regions is enough for all vcpus.
> >
> > Finally, this patch also enables some extra tests in
> > vgic_v3_alloc_redist_region() by calculating "size" early for the legacy
> > redist api: like checking that the REDIST region can fit all the already
> > created vcpus.

> 
> This actually fixes theĀ  vgic_dist_overlap(kvm, base, size=0)
> 
> in case the number of online-vcpus at that time is less than the final
> one (1st run), if count=0 (legacy API) do we ever check that the RDIST
> (with accumulated vcpu rdists) does not overlap with dist.
> in other words shouldn't we call vgic_dist_overlap(kvm, base, size)
> again in vgic_v3_check_base().
> 

I think we're good; that's checked by vgic_v3_rdist_overlap(dist_base)
in vgic_v3_check_base(). This function uses the only region (legacy
case) using a size based on the online_vcpus (in
vgic_v3_rd_region_size()).  This exact situation is tested by
test_vgic_then_vcpus() in the vgic_init selftest.
